What Does a Semi Truck Accident Lawyer Actually Handle?

A semi truck accident lawyer is a legal advocate who specializes in claims arising from accidents caused by commercial trucks, 18-wheelers, big rigs, and other oversized transport trucks. These cases involve a specialized understanding of FMCSA compliance standards that go well beyond typical auto accident litigation.

From a legal standpoint, a semi truck accident lawyer pursues all possible sources of fault. This means examining the truck driver, the trucking company, the vehicle manufacturer, and even third-party shippers. FMCSA rules govern logbook requirements, vehicle maintenance schedules, and weight distribution requirements — all of which frequently are key evidence in your case.

The attorney will obtain trucking logs, black box data, repair logs, and dash cam video to reconstruct the accident. This methodical investigation is the reason a semi truck accident lawyer from a typical injury lawyer — the technical expertise required to pursue full compensation at the strongest possible standard.

The Semi Truck Accident Lawyer Procedure Step by Step

  1. The No-Cost Case Review — You meet with a semi truck accident lawyer to discuss the facts of your crash. The lawyer gathers key information to determine the strength of your case at no obligation to you.
  2. Securing the Case Record — The attorney immediately sends spoliation notices to prevent destruction of critical truck data. Expert investigators may be retained to establish how the crash occurred.
  3. Building the Full Picture of Your Damages — The legal staff obtains all healthcare reports, diagnostic imaging, and future treatment estimates to document every aspect of your physical harm.
  4. Establishing Who Is Responsible — The semi truck accident lawyer examines hours-of-service data, maintenance histories, and employer practices to pinpoint fault and develop a strong liability theory.
  5. Quantifying Every Category of Loss — Calculable costs like hospital expenses and lost wages are paired alongside non-economic damages like diminished quality of life to create a full compensation package.
  6. Settlement Negotiations With Carriers and Insurers — Backed by a complete case file, the semi truck accident lawyer pushes back firmly against defense attorneys to achieve a just resolution without prolonged litigation.
  7. Trial Preparation and Courtroom Litigation if Needed — Should the insurer refuse a reasonable offer, your semi truck accident lawyer is fully prepared to take your case to trial and advocate for maximum compensation.

What evidence is most important in a semi truck accident case?

Key pieces of evidence includes electronic logging device data, driver qualification files, vehicle service records, cargo weight and loading records, and any available dash cam or traffic cam footage. Your semi truck accident lawyer will work fast to obtain this data before it can be erased.

What if the defense claims I contributed to the accident?

California follows a pure comparative negligence system, which means injured parties can still pursue compensation even if you were a contributing factor. Your final compensation is simply adjusted based on your degree of fault. A semi truck accident lawyer will fight to lower any fault assigned to you.

What's the deadline to file a truck accident claim in California?

In California, the legal filing deadline for truck accident lawsuits is two years from the date of injury. Missing this deadline can end your ability to pursue a settlement. Contacting a semi truck accident lawyer without delay ensures we protect this critical timeframe.
